Biblical Foundation For Intercessory Prayer
The Bible is full of examples of people praying for others. Abraham prayed for Sodom. Moses interceded for Israel. Jesus prayed for his disciples and for all believers.
James 5:16 says, “Confess your trespasses to one another, and pray for one another, that you may be healed. The effective, fervent prayer of a righteous man avails much.” This verse directly connects prayer for others with healing and breakthrough.
Your prayer for a friend’s family is not optional. It is a command and a privilege. It aligns your heart with God’s heart for unity and love.
Key Bible Verses To Pray Over Families
- Numbers 6:24-26 – The Aaronic blessing for protection and peace
- Psalm 127:1 – Unless the Lord builds the house, they labor in vain
- Joshua 24:15 – Choosing to serve the Lord as a household
- Ephesians 3:16-19 – Strength, love, and fullness in Christ
- Philippians 4:6-7 – Peace that guards hearts and minds

How To Pray When You Don’T Know What To Say
Sometimes the pain is too deep for words. That is okay. The Holy Spirit intercedes for us with groans that cannot be uttered (Romans 8:26).
You can pray in silence. You can pray with tears. You can pray by simply saying, “Lord, you know. Please help.”
Another powerful way is to pray Scripture. Take a verse like Psalm 34:18 – “The Lord is near to the brokenhearted” – and personalize it for your friend’s family.
- Start with a breath prayer: Inhale peace, exhale worry.
- Name the specific need: “Lord, heal their mother’s heart.”
- Ask for God’s presence: “Be near to them right now.”
- Trust the outcome: “I release this into your hands.”

How To Create A Prayer Routine For A Friend’S Family
Consistency matters. You can build a simple routine that keeps your friend’s family in your prayers daily.
- Choose a specific time – morning, lunch, or bedtime.
- Keep a list of names and needs in a journal or phone note.
- Use a prayer app or a physical reminder like a sticky note.
- Pray with your own family for your friend’s family.
- Review and update your prayer list regularly.
Even five minutes a day can make a huge difference. Your faithfulness in prayer builds a spiritual hedge around them.
